summaryrefslogtreecommitdiff
path: root/source3
diff options
context:
space:
mode:
authorTim Potter <tpot@samba.org>2003-04-28 03:33:56 +0000
committerTim Potter <tpot@samba.org>2003-04-28 03:33:56 +0000
commit39fbda7f036fa615ac46a7c9729e1f420972208b (patch)
tree2f00fb87ca73f53d42fc424051c565835718b5fd /source3
parent9b93eb6f82a349273b6e402d9623179785cadce1 (diff)
downloadsamba-39fbda7f036fa615ac46a7c9729e1f420972208b.tar.gz
samba-39fbda7f036fa615ac46a7c9729e1f420972208b.tar.bz2
samba-39fbda7f036fa615ac46a7c9729e1f420972208b.zip
Return NT_STATUS_UNSUCCESSFUL if the sourcedata and echodata rpcs
return unexpected data. Closes bug #2. (This used to be commit 0c3314ab97331aa709216e7ad2a1a0c8605eb160)
Diffstat (limited to 'source3')
-rw-r--r--source3/rpcclient/cmd_echo.c2
1 files changed, 2 insertions, 0 deletions
diff --git a/source3/rpcclient/cmd_echo.c b/source3/rpcclient/cmd_echo.c
index 79ba744a55..fa4e691663 100644
--- a/source3/rpcclient/cmd_echo.c
+++ b/source3/rpcclient/cmd_echo.c
@@ -74,6 +74,7 @@ static NTSTATUS cmd_echo_data(struct cli_state *cli, TALLOC_CTX *mem_ctx,
if (in_data[i] != out_data[i]) {
printf("mismatch at offset %d, %d != %d\n",
i, in_data[i], out_data[i]);
+ result = NT_STATUS_UNSUCCESSFUL;
}
}
@@ -107,6 +108,7 @@ static NTSTATUS cmd_echo_source_data(struct cli_state *cli,
if (out_data && out_data[i] != (i & 0xff)) {
printf("mismatch at offset %d, %d != %d\n",
i, out_data[i], i & 0xff);
+ result = NT_STATUS_UNSUCCESSFUL;
}
}